Amos Lee Winter Tour
. The tour will kick off at the Moore Theater in Seattle on January 20 and will include stops along the west coast, in the mountain states, and in the southwest, including a concert in Tucson, Arizona where Lee recorded Mission Bell at Wavelab Studio with producer Joey Burns of Calexico. Opening for Lee on the tour will be South African singer-songwriter Vusi Mahlasela. Lee will also be touring for the remainder of 2010, including support dates for Dave Matthews Band (November 2-3). On December 3, Lee's WXPN "Free At Noon" performance at World Caf� in Philadelphia will also be webcast live by NPR Music. WFUV has announced Lee to headline their 6th Annual Holiday Cheer show on December 6 at the New York Society for Ethical Culture. He will also be the featured performer on Levon Helm's intimate Midnight Ramble concert series in Woodstock, New York, on December 4. See below for a full list of tour dates.
